diff options
author | matclab | 2018-04-11 22:21:53 +0200 |
---|---|---|
committer | matclab | 2018-04-11 22:22:22 +0200 |
commit | 3817428bf828614beae05bd04e4f21ef227186ce (patch) | |
tree | 7a9d055e07a87f8439bfef82f5eb136bd855cead | |
parent | 5573287f961c20774e9e1d62eb6e585b4889c9da (diff) | |
download | aur-3817428bf828614beae05bd04e4f21ef227186ce.tar.gz |
Correct systemd service
-rw-r--r-- | .SRCINFO | 4 | ||||
-rw-r--r-- | PKGBUILD | 4 | ||||
-rw-r--r-- | prometheus-nginxlog-exporter.service | 7 |
3 files changed, 9 insertions, 6 deletions
@@ -1,7 +1,7 @@ pkgbase = prometheus-nginxlog-exporter-bin pkgdesc = Export metrics from Nginx access log files to Prometheus pkgver = 1.2.0 - pkgrel = 1 + pkgrel = 2 url = https://github.com/martin-helmich/prometheus-nginxlog-exporter/ arch = x86_64 license = Apache @@ -11,7 +11,7 @@ pkgbase = prometheus-nginxlog-exporter-bin source = prometheus-nginxlog-exporter.service source = config.yml source = https://github.com/martin-helmich/prometheus-nginxlog-exporter//releases/download/v1.2.0/prometheus-nginxlog-exporter - md5sums = c6a8077b0dee0f3a748ee73b7c146044 + md5sums = eb93cf58698a0015dd3124c1c1653fbf md5sums = 7f951e89fda154346240c0f0eb9223ce md5sums = aca2467d2cbd7caed90e2dd8274a5817 @@ -3,7 +3,7 @@ pkgname=prometheus-nginxlog-exporter-bin _name=prometheus-nginxlog-exporter pkgver=1.2.0 -pkgrel=1 +pkgrel=2 pkgdesc="Export metrics from Nginx access log files to Prometheus" arch=('x86_64') @@ -31,6 +31,6 @@ package() { install -D -m0644 "${srcdir}/config.yml" \ "${pkgdir}/etc/prometheus/nginxlog.yml" } -md5sums=('c6a8077b0dee0f3a748ee73b7c146044' +md5sums=('eb93cf58698a0015dd3124c1c1653fbf' '7f951e89fda154346240c0f0eb9223ce' 'aca2467d2cbd7caed90e2dd8274a5817') diff --git a/prometheus-nginxlog-exporter.service b/prometheus-nginxlog-exporter.service index c2034b14128f..8923b64000a6 100644 --- a/prometheus-nginxlog-exporter.service +++ b/prometheus-nginxlog-exporter.service @@ -3,8 +3,11 @@ Description=Prometheus NginxLog Exporter After=network.target [Service] -User=prometheus -ExecStart=/usr/bin/prometheus_nginxlog_exporter --config.file="/etc/prometheus/nginxlog.yml" +ExecStart=/usr/bin/prometheus-nginxlog-exporter -config-file "/etc/prometheus/nginxlog.yml" +Restart=always +ProtectSystem=full +CapabilityBoundingSet= + [Install] WantedBy=multi-user.target |